FAQs

What traits should I look for in a freelance software architect?

Look for someone who knows a lot about designing systems. They should be good at solving problems and thinking ahead. A top architect should communicate well and work nicely with a team. Make sure they have experience with projects like yours. Remember, they are the bridge between your ideas and the final product.

How can I check the architect's past work?

Review their portfolio to see projects they've worked on. Look for case studies or examples similar to what you need. Ask for testimonials or references from past clients. This will help you understand their expertise and style. Good architects often have work that shows their problem-solving skills.

Why is it important to discuss project goals with the architect?

Discussing goals ensures everyone understands what needs to be done. It helps the architect design a system that meets your vision. Clear goals prevent misunderstandings later on. It also helps in setting the right timeline and budget. This step ensures the architect knows the priorities.

How can I ensure the project stays on track?

Create a detailed project plan with the architect. Set milestones and deadlines together. Regular check-ins and updates help keep things moving smoothly. Make sure there’s a way to handle any issues quickly. Keeping communication open is key.

What should be included in the project deliverables?

Deliverables should be specific and detailed. Include diagrams, code, and documentation pieces. Ensure that the architect understands what's expected in each phase. Each deliverable should align with your project goals. This helps track progress and quality.

How do I set the right expectations with an architect?

Talk openly about what you need and when you need it. Share the big picture of your project, including future plans. Discuss any constraints like time or resources. Be clear on quality standards and timelines. This way, the architect knows what you expect from start to finish.

Why should I agree on a communication plan with the architect?

A communication plan sets how and when you will talk. It helps both of you stay updated on the project's progress. Decide on the best channels and frequency for updates. This prevents any surprises and helps build trust. It’s important to keep everyone in the loop.

What should I ask about the architect's problem-solving approach?

Ask how they usually handle challenges or changes in a project. Find out if they have strategies for dealing with unexpected issues. A good architect can create solutions and remain flexible. They should be able to adjust plans when needed. Understanding their approach helps you know how they think.

How can I ensure a smooth onboarding process?

Prepare all necessary information and tools the architect will need. Have a clear and organized introduction to your team and project. Discuss roles and responsibilities upfront. Make sure they have access to required resources and systems. A smooth start sets the tone for successful collaboration.
